延边黄牛体细胞克隆融合条件的研究

摘    要:以体外成熟培养22-24h的延边黄牛卵母细胞作为受体,颗粒细胞为供核细胞,挤压法去核,注入供体颗粒细胞到卵黄周隙中,甘露醇融合液中施加20μs时长的电脉冲刺激使之融合,复合化学方法激活,从融合前恢复培养时间、融合电场强度、甘露醇浓度等3个方面研究延边黄牛体细胞克隆的适宜融合条件.结果表明,2.5h处理组的融合率(70.9%)显著高于4.0h处理组(58.2%,P〈0.05),2.5h处理组重组胚的卵裂率(77.9%)显著高于其它4组(P〈O.05),其它各组间差异不显著(P〉0.05);融合电场强度1100V/cm处理组的融合率(86.4%)显著高于900V/cm处理组(67.1%)和1200V/cm处理组(75.2%,P〈O.05),重组胚的卵裂率(84.6%)显著高于900V/cm处理组(69.6%,P〈O.05),囊胚发育率(26.1%)显著高于900V/cm处理组(10.0%),1200V/cm处理组(8.0%,P〈O.05);不同浓度的甘露醇对融合率和重组胚的卵裂率没有明显的影响,但是0.28mol/L组囊胚发育率(25.3%)显著高于0.25mol/L组(15.3%,P〈0.05).因此,适合延边黄牛体细胞克隆的融合条件为融合前恢复培养2.5h,0.28mol/L甘露醇作为融合液,电场强度1100V/cm.

Study of fusion condition of somatic cell cloning of Yanbian Yellow Cattle

Abstract:Make the oocytes IVM 22--24 h as recipient cells, granulosa cells as donor cells, by acupressure enucleated oocytes method putting donor granulosa cells into yolk space, fu- sion with mannitol solution imposed 20 μs electrical pulse length, activated with chemical activator compound,investigate the suitable fusion conditions of somatic cell cloning of Yan- bian Yellow Cattle from recovery time before fusion, electric field strength in fusion and concentration of rnannitol The results showed that fusion rate of 2.5 h treatment group (70.9%) was significantly higher than 4.0 h treatment group (58.2% ,p〈0.05), cleavage rate of 2.5 h treatment group (77.9%) was significantly higher than the other 4 treatment groups, there was no significant difference in the 4 treatment groups (p〉0.05); fusion rate of 1 100 V/cm treatment group (86. 4%) was significantly higher than 900 V/cm treatment group (67.1%) and 1 200 V/cm treatment group (75.2%,p〈0.05), cleavage rate of 1 100 V/cm treatment group (84. 60//00) was significantly higher than 900 V/cm treatment group (69. 6%, p〈0. 05), blastocyst rate of ll00V/cm treatment group (26.1%) was significantly higher than 900 V/cm treatment group (10.0%) and 1 200 V/ cm treatment group (8.0 %, p〈0.05) . effects of different concentrations of mannitol on fu- sion rate and cleavage rate were not significantly different, but the blastocyst rate of 0.28 mol/L treatment group (25.3 %) was significantly higher than 0.25 mol/L treatment group (15.3%, p~0. 05). Concluded that suitable fusion conditions of somatic cell cloning in Yanbian Yellow Cattle was recovery time before fusion in 2.5 h, the concentration of with 0.28 mol/L,electric field strength in fusion with 1 100 V/cm.
